Description
“He’s reamplifying the tradition of jazz piano and he’s lifting up a legacy that’s the foundation  for many people” -New York Times. Accomplished multi-instrumentalist Luther S. Allison has set himself apart as one of the most in-demand artists in jazz today. The Charlotte, North  Carolina native is recognized for his blues-based, gospel inspired playing with deep roots in the  tradition of bebop and soul music. Upon completion of his Masters in Music in 2019, Allison  began a consistent international touring career on both instruments supporting the likes of  Jazzmeia Horn, Helen Sung, Samara Joy, Rodney Whitaker, Etienne Charles,  The Baylor Project, and Ulysses Owens Jr.  Rated 4.5 stars by Downbeat, Allison’s debut album, I Owe It All To You was described as  “a portrait of a straight-ahead pianist who seems to have no weak points in his arsenal” - Downbeat. Allison is also featured as a sideman on numerous projects – notably the  GRAMMY Award Winning single, Tight, supporting vocalist Samara Joy.  In addition to his work as a bandleader and sideman, Allison is a consummate educator and  curator – having operated as Adjunct Jazz Faculty (4 years) and Chair of the Percussion  Department (2 years) at The Calhoun School in New York City. Moreover, Allison has  curated, and music directed performances in conjunction with both the Louis Armstrong  Museum and The National Jazz Museum in Harlem in New York, New York.   As a composer, Allison has already begun to leave an indelible mark, leading to him being  commissioned by Wynton Marsalis to compose an original work for the esteemed Jazz at  Lincoln Center Orchestra. Alongside his achievements as a musician/composer/music  director, Allison is featured as both an actor and recorded musician on Maggie Gylenhaal’s upcoming film The Bride, contributing on screen along with several recorded tracks for the  film score.   Luther Allison is a proud YAMAHA artist.
